![]() To be fair, all I really want at this point is a really good US blu of AOD. Evil Dead is perfect (right down to giving options to watch in its original 4X3, or the newly approved 16x9 version), as is Evil Dead 2 (Lionsgate saved us from that dated DNR travesty that Anchor Bay put out in blu-ray's early days). It's ironic that the biggest budgeted and most "Hollywood" of the trilogy is the one that gets kicked around the most with so many meh releases. Although I also wouldn't mind a re-release of the "remakequel" with the deleted scenes that appeared on UK TV. |

Currently the only versions of this movie are both DVDs, the MGM Hong Kong release and the 2-disc UK release by Anchor Bay.
Which blu-ray releases should I buy that'd preserve all the bonus materials from these releases? Did "Men Behind the Army" even make it across the format change? Also, reading up on the different versions made me wonder what the hell it was I had on VHS many years ago. I always thought it was the international cut, since it included many scenes from the director's cut while omitting others, but it used the apocalyptic ending rather than the S-Mart ending, and with the "I ain't that good" line, the version I had pretty much ended up omitting all of Ash's most famous one-liners from the film. Sounds like it was the same as the later UK video version which also switched the ending around, except the Finnish tape excluded the S-Mart ending post-credit bonus.
